Lamb Stew Pasta

Rich & Hearty Stew ~
INGREDIENTS:-
2 Packs of Lamb steak from Merdeka Supermarket
1/2 teaspoon Salt & Pepper
2 teaspoon sugar
1/2 cup water
4 cups beef stock ( use maggie beef stock to replace)
3 cloves Garlic, minced
2 Large Onion
2 Carrots, diced
2 potatoes, cube
1 tablespoon dried thyme
2 bay leaves
1 cup white wine ( * can be an optional item.....)

A. Chop Lamb into pieces, & marinate with salt & pepper & thyme

Pan fried ( but I wok - fried) them! hahahah.. then place the meat into stock pot with water & beef stock. Fried the onion & garlic ... and put together into the pot and boil for half & hour...then put all the carrot & potato in... continue to simmer for another 1/2 hour until tender.
